Gurugram-based e-commerce enablement platform Shiprocket, which is backed by Bertelsmann, Tribe Capital, Temasek, and Eternal, has filed an updated Draft Red Herring Prospectus (UDRHP) with the SEBI to raise Rs 2,342.3 crore via an initial public offering (IPO).

Shiprocket enables MSMEs to go online, scale their businesses, ship pan-India and globally, manage payments and checkout, handle marketing and customer engagement as well.

The professionally managed company proposed raising Rs 1,100 crore by issuing fresh shares, while investors and others will be offloading up to Rs 1,242.3 crore worth of shares via offer-for-sale, as per the DRHP filed on December 12.

Lightrock, Arvind, Tribe Capital, Bertelsmann, Gautam Kapoor, Saahil Goel, and Vishesh Khurana are among the selling shareholders in the offer-for-sale.
